Q: Is 28,384,243 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 28,384,243 is a composite number.

Why is 28,384,243 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 28,384,243 can be evenly divided by 1 29 331 2,957 9,599 85,753 978,767 and 28,384,243, with no remainder.

Since 28,384,243 cannot be divided by just 1 and 28,384,243, it is a composite number.
